COA Mixture Relaunched in Accra
SharePost to XSendShareSend

The Founder and Chief Executive Officer of COA Research and Manufacturing Company Limited, Professor Samuel Ato Duncan, has said that due to new properties he has added to COA Mixture (formerly COA FS), the herbal medicine is now fit to be prescribed by qualified medical doctors across Ghana.

According to him, the new COA Mixture has been accepted and approved by the Ministry of Health and has been added to the list of essential drugs by the Ministry.

Professor Duncan disclosed this to journalists during the re-launch of the COA Mixture on Wednesday in Accra.

People with HIV/AIDS, he says, can take COA Mixture not to cure the disease, but to stay fit for the rest of their lives.

Professor Duncan also cautioned people living with HIV and AIDS not to put a hold on their anti-retroviral drugs once they have COA Mixture but rather use the two drugs concurrently as prescribed by a qualified medical professional.

He again explained that patients with all kinds of ailments can take COA Mixture too, but one hour before food.

Furthermore, he cautioned the general public against buying fake and imitated versions of the mixture, adding that he had received multiple calls from across the country with regards to people who claimed to have worked with him before but were no longer with the company and were now producing similar products.

In attendance at the re-launch were the Health Minister, Kwaku Agyeman Manu, and the Trade and Industry Minister, Alan Kyeremanten.
